About Fredericksburg, OH
Fredericksburg is a small community in Ohio with a population of 425 residents. The median household income is $75,547 per year, which is above the national average. The median age in Fredericksburg is 32.7 years.
Housing in Fredericksburg has a median home value of $145,300 and median monthly rent of $994. Of the 179 total housing units, the majority are owner-occupied, with 111 owner-occupied and 38 renter-occupied units.
The unemployment rate in Fredericksburg is 0.0% and the poverty rate is 4.0%. 15.4% of residents h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The average commute time is 20 minutes.
Cost of Living in Fredericksburg, OH
Compared to national averages, Fredericksburg has a median household income of $75,547 (1% above the national median of $75,149). Home values average $145,300, which is 41% below the national median. Monthly rent at $994 is 15% below the US average of $1,163. Within Ohio, Fredericksburg's income is 5% above the state average of $71,814, and home values are 17% below the state median of $174,449.
